Posted by: Skate323k137 on 2022-10-21 09:19:15 Apple II stuff is [finally?] climbing a bit in price. I would wager since original systems are still present in such numbers that previously clones didn't garner much attention from the average person or collector. Now, since original systems are starting to command some $$, I can see clones starting to have a little value and perhaps sell for more, given I doubt most are present in numbers anywhere close to Apple's production runs.

Posted by: LaPorta on 2022-10-25 20:54:35 My Machine says "M-I-C ][" instead of Apple II when started. That mean anything to anyone? |
Posted by: bibilit on 2022-10-26 00:07:10 Hard to say, many clones used the same space than the original to display a start message.
So your M-I-C is the equivalent of APPLE.
MIC can be the brand, modified to suit.
Some had « Ready Go » instead, again using the same spacing. |
